How to Decorate Your Home with Plants for a Fresh Feel

Incorporating plants into your home décor is an excellent way to infuse life, color, and a fresh feel into your living space. Not only do plants enhance the aesthetic appeal of your home, but they also improve air quality and bring a sense of tranquility. Whether you have a green thumb or are a novice plant enthusiast, here’s a guide to decorating your home with plants for a vibrant and refreshing atmosphere.

1. Choose the Right Plants for Your Space

The first step in decorating with plants is selecting the right varieties that suit your home environment. Consider factors such as light availability, temperature, and humidity levels in different rooms. Here are some plant suggestions based on lighting:

  • Low Light: Snake Plant, ZZ Plant, Pothos
  • Medium Light: Peace Lily, Spider Plant, Philodendron
  • Bright Light: Fiddle Leaf Fig, Rubber Plant, Succulents

2. Create a Green Focal Point

Introduce a stunning focal point in your living room or entryway with a large, eye-catching plant like a Monstera or a Ficus Tree. Position it where it can be admired and where it will receive adequate light. A tall plant in a decorative pot can transform an empty corner and add height to your décor.

3. Use Plants as Wall Art

Vertical gardens or wall-mounted planters are fantastic ways to utilize wall space while adding greenery to your home. You can create a living wall with a variety of plants for a lush, green backdrop. Alternatively, hang individual planters or trailing plants like String of Pearls or English Ivy for a cascading effect.

4. Incorporate Plants into Shelving

Integrate plants into your shelving units or bookcases for a layered, organic look. Mix and match plant sizes and textures, placing them alongside books and decorative objects. Small plants like succulents or air plants are perfect for this purpose and add interest without overwhelming the space.

5. Brighten Up Your Kitchen

Herbs such as basil, mint, and rosemary not only freshen up your kitchen but are also practical for cooking. Place them on a sunny windowsill or in hanging planters. Their vibrant green leaves and aromatic scents will enhance your culinary space.

6. Enhance Your Bathroom with Humidity-Loving Plants

Bathrooms are ideal for humidity-loving plants like ferns, orchids, and bamboo. These plants thrive in the moist environment and can transform your bathroom into a spa-like retreat. Place them on countertops or hang them from the ceiling for a tropical feel.

7. Add a Touch of Green to Your Bedroom

Promote relaxation in your bedroom with plants that improve air quality and promote sleep, such as Lavender and Jasmine. Place them on bedside tables or use a plant stand to create a calming green corner.

8. Experiment with Plant Containers

The choice of containers can significantly impact the overall look of your plant décor. Experiment with different styles, such as terracotta pots for a rustic feel, sleek metal planters for a modern touch, or colorful ceramic pots to add a pop of color. Ensure that pots have adequate drainage to keep your plants healthy.

9. Group Plants for Visual Impact

Grouping plants together can create a lush, cohesive look. Use odd numbers for a more natural arrangement and vary plant heights and textures for depth. This technique works well on coffee tables, window sills, and sideboards.

10. Maintain Your Green Oasis

Finally, regular plant care is essential to keep your home looking fresh and vibrant. Water your plants according to their specific needs, clean leaves to allow for optimal photosynthesis, and prune regularly to encourage healthy growth.
